Comprehending Registered Representatives

A registered representative plays a important role in the business landscape, serving as a designated individual or entity accountable for accepting official documents and legal notices on behalf of a business. This includes important communication such as legal summons, tax information, and compliance documents. In many jurisdictions, employing a registered agent is not just recommended, but a mandatory for companies, including LLCs and corporations. By acting as a intermediary between the business and the government, registered agents ensure that businesses remain aware and in compliance with state regulations.

The requirements for registered agents vary by jurisdiction, but all must be available during standard business hours and typically maintain a tangible address in the jurisdiction where the company is registered. This location serves as the official registered office where crucial documents can be delivered. As companies expand nationally or operate in multiple jurisdictions, many choose to engage a professional registered agent service provider to manage these responsibilities effectively. This not only aids in ensuring timely delivery of documents but also enhances the overall reputation and integrity of the business.

In addition to legal compliance, registered agents offer key benefits, such as confidentiality. By using a registered agent, company owners can keep their personal addresses confidential, as the registered agent's address will be listed in public records. Furthermore, many registered agent companies provide additional services such as yearly compliance alerts, document management, and even assistance with company formation. Key Requirements and Costs

To operate as a registered agent, numerous basic requirements must be met. A licensed agent is required to have a physical address inside the region in which the company is formed, which is often referred to as the registered office. This address must be a physical street address, not a mailbox, and must be accessible in normal business hours to receive legal documents on behalf of the business. Additionally, the designated agent ought to be a natural person or a company authorized to conduct business in the state, which guarantees compliance with local regulations.

The expenses linked to registered agent provisions can vary significantly based on factors such as the provider, the geographic area, and the particular services offered.
